Hello fellow reefers. I am from South Africa. Here is my Nano reef tank which I call Tropical heat. Tank age 2 years and 8 months old. It's 60cm long. Water volume 70 lt. Lightning via ecotech radion xr30 gen 3 pro. Dosing two part +kalkwasser. Nutrient control via refugium with cheato + diy nopox. Skimmer bubble magus curve 5. Sonoff controller used on skimmer, ato, refugium and return pump. Enjoying the journey. Definitely not a race. Pics of my system below. I do move corals from time to time to find a sweet spot and experiment with the look of the aquascape.
